Перейти к содержанию

VladOr

Пользователи
  • Постов

    136
  • Зарегистрирован

  • Посещение

Сообщения, опубликованные VladOr

  1. последняя на лицензии и предпоследняя на нуле

    Все, можно закрывать. Сам понял. Это все относится к ТОП пользователей, а не к Лидерам

    :( а мне надо как раз лидеров сделать 8 штук а не 4

  2. Ребят, подскажите, куда копнуть.

    Хочу сменить на главной странице Таблице лидеров количество их, сделать вместо стандартных 4-х восемь.

    Казалось бы простая задача, в настройках выставляю количество на основной странице - 8 и оставляю только по репутации, что бы мне не показывала публикации.

    Screenshot_86.thumb.png.0d8ca6b3066e66d09704fbb9327cea09.png

    Настройки применяются, но при этом на самой странице Лидеров не меняется ни чего.

    Проверил на двух сайтах, на одном лицензия, на другом мафиевский нуль.

    Заранее спасибо.

  3. В 30.06.2017 в 21:47, Dmitriy427 сказал:

    Там написано - куда копать.  Статическая переменная "$contentItemClass", класса "IPS\collections\Category", не объявлена. Либо в файле /applications/collections/sources/Category/Category.php ошибка, либо в одном из контроллеров использующих этот класс.

    Это я вижу по логу, но мне не понятно, почему с админскими и модерскими правами - все нормально, она блин объявляется, а вот с простыми юзерскими нет

  4. Приложение Collection. Официально купленное через IPS. 

    Написал автору в поддержке приложения - ответа нет, наверно сложно для него :) Думаю, здесь наши спецы поумнее будут :)

    Короче, все видимые права на приложение, форум поддержки приложения, категории внутри приложения выставлены по максимуму (после начала косяков, для проверки - косяки остались)

    В чем проявляется:

    Все группы (Админы, модеры, юзеры) - спокойно создают новый предмет коллекции. После создания админы и модеры безошибочно переходят в созданный предмет, у юзеров сразу вылетает ошибка. При этом есть смотреть в категории предметов - новый предмет создан.

    Категории предметов видят все. В любой предмет могут перейти админы и модеры. Юзеры и гости получают ошибку, стандартную EX0 что то пошло не так.

    Переведя группу юзеров в администрацию и дав им все права - ошибка пропадает. Но это, блин не правильно же.

    Ошибка в логах:

    Error: Access to undeclared static property: IPS\collections\Category::$contentItemClass (0)
    #0 /var/www/vlador/data/www/galaknika.ru/system/Content/Content.php(476): IPS\Node\_Model->modPermission('view_hidden', Object(IPS\Member))
    #1 /var/www/vlador/data/www/galaknika.ru/system/Content/Item.php(5490): IPS\_Content::modPermission('view_hidden', Object(IPS\Member), Object(IPS\collections\Category))
    #2 /var/www/vlador/data/www/galaknika.ru/system/Content/Item.php(2975): IPS\Content\_Item->canViewHiddenComments()
    #3 /var/www/vlador/data/www/galaknika.ru/system/Content/Item.php(2951): IPS\Content\_Item->commentCount()
    #4 [internal function]: IPS\Content\_Item->commentPageCount()
    #5 /var/www/vlador/data/www/galaknika.ru/system/Content/Controller.php(104): call_user_func(Array)
    #6 /var/www/vlador/data/www/galaknika.ru/init.php(447) : eval()'d code(15): IPS\Content\_Controller->manage()
    #7 /var/www/vlador/data/www/galaknika.ru/applications/collections/modules/front/collections/item.php(85): IPS\Content\rules_hook_ipsContentController->manage()
    #8 /var/www/vlador/data/www/galaknika.ru/system/Dispatcher/Controller.php(96): IPS\collections\modules\front\collections\_item->manage()
    #9 /var/www/vlador/data/www/galaknika.ru/system/Content/Controller.php(50): IPS\Dispatcher\_Controller->execute()
    #10 /var/www/vlador/data/www/galaknika.ru/applications/collections/modules/front/collections/item.php(34): IPS\Content\_Controller->execute()
    #11 /var/www/vlador/data/www/galaknika.ru/system/Dispatcher/Dispatcher.php(142): IPS\collections\modules\front\collections\_item->execute()
    #12 /var/www/vlador/data/www/galaknika.ru/index.php(12): IPS\_Dispatcher->run()
    #13 {main}

    Обратная трассировка:

    #0 /var/www/vlador/data/www/galaknika.ru/init.php(515): IPS\_Log::log('Error: Access t...', 'uncaught_except...')
    #1 [internal function]: IPS\IPS::exceptionHandler(Object(Error))
    #2 {main}

    Чистил кэш. Отключал все приложения и плагины. Отключал установленную русификацию. Включал стандартную тему.

    Результат тот же.

    Гуру, подскажите, куда копать?

  5. 22 часа назад, plast1kov сказал:

    1) Во вкладке "поисковая оптимизация" могу добавить только один мета-тег. Можно ли добавить больше?

    По очереди добавляете сколько надо.

    22 часа назад, plast1kov сказал:

    2) Не могу понять как работает "онлайн редактор мета-тегов"

    Справа открывается окно, в котором на нужной странице частично автозаполняются теги. В принципе, все заполняется как надо, нужно только менять описание. Редактируете, сохраняете и страница появляется со своими тегами во вкладке "поисковая оптимизация"

  6. Добрый день.

    В настройках есть возможность указать автоматическое встраивание к публикуемым линкам атрибута "nofollow"

    Но в этом случае при необходимости убрать этот атрибут не получается, так как при публикации он все равно автоматически подставляется

    Подскажите как можно сделать, что бы при установленном для всех автоматическом встраивании этого атрибута, он не встраивался, например, при публикации админом, либо, например, при публикации на Страницах (а во всех остальных местах пусть).

    Главное, не могу в коде найти место, которое отвечает за это, так бы попробовал сам пошаманить

  7. 2 часа назад, Silence сказал:

    Попробуй:

    в корен ваш форум /system/Login/VK.php найти и измени:

    
    array( 'photo' => TRUE,

    измени на:

    
    array( 'photo' => FALSE,

     

    Не заработало.

    Т.е. и аватары остались и в смене аватара остался пункт "Синхронизировать с ВК" и при загрузке страницы так же аватары тянет с ВК

    Зато в папке applications/core/sources/ProfileSync/

    Нашел вот такой код:

    public function photo()
    	{
    		try
    		{
    			$response = \IPS\Http\Url::external( "https://api.vk.com/method/getProfiles?uid={$this->member->vk_id}&access_token={$this->member->vk_token}&fields=photo_max_orig&https=" . intval( \IPS\Request::i()->isSecure() ) )->request()->get()->decodeJson();
    
    			if( ! isset( $response['response'][0]['photo_max_orig'] ) OR \strpos( $response['response'][0]['photo_max_orig'], 'camera_a.gif' ) !== false )
    			{
    				return NULL;
    			}
    
    			try
    			{
    				return \IPS\Http\Url::external( $response['response'][0]['photo_max_orig'] );
    			}
    			catch (\Exception $e) {}
    				
    			return NULL;
    		}
    		catch ( \IPS\Http\Request\Exception $e )
    		{
    			return NULL;
    		}
    	}
    	

    Может кто разберется что в нем порезать-поменять?

    По мне так все external надо выковыривать и убирать оттуда

    Забыл написать, в папке той файл VK.php

    Нда.. заменой этого кода по аналогии с Twitter.php на код:

    {
    		return $this->resourceUrl( $this->user(), 'profile_image_url' );
    	}

    результата не дало :(

    все осталось по прежнему

  8. Спасибо! Пока не сделал, так как возник еще один вопрос.

    Правильно я понимаю, что использование False заставит новых пользователей с ВК уже самостоятельно подгружать аватары, но не удалит аватары уже имеющиеся?

    Или все аватары пользователей с ВК пропадут и им придется подгружать новые?

  9. Silence, спасибо, но это немного не то. Этот плагин отключает возможность загрузки удаленного аватара.

    Но ситуацию с аватарами из ВК он не решает.

    Т.е. когда пользователь заходит через ВК у него аватар подцеплется из ВК и по умолчанию синхронизируется с ВК

    4.jpg

    Т.е. только сам пользователь через настройку аватара в профиле может отключить синхронизпцию.

    А хотелось бы, что бы после регистрации через ВК, аватар падал на сервер и больше не синхрился с ВК.

    Ибо при загрузке страницы подгрузка аватаров с ВК занимает кучу времени

     

  10. Подскажите, как сделать, что бы аватары пользователей хранились только на сервере?

    Сейчас пользователи, зарегистрированные и вошедшие через ВКонтакте имеют аватары, которые каждый раз тянуться с ВК

    Тут блин посмотрел, один 40 кБ аватар загружается на сайт больше секунды!

  11. Не работает. в том то и дело.

    Вы расшаривании вылезает пикча откуда угодно, только не из расшариваемого контента и кнопка перебора картинок. С помощью кнопки я могу за несколько кликов добраться до нужной картинки, но меня это не устраивает.

    Я то смогу выбрать нужное, а юзеры точно не будут искать нужную, а прилепят первую попавшуюся

  12. 10 минут назад, VladOr сказал:

    Попробуй переустановить плагин.

    Я тоже его использую со стандартными настройками. Работает нормально, показывает именно последние сообщения из темы.

    А вот и нет, наврал.

    Вернее, неправильно понял ТС

    Если включить показ сообщений, то действительно показывает самое первое сообщение темы.

    При этом, если вывод сообщений отключить, то темы поднимает нормально после обновления последнего сообщения.

  13. 9 часов назад, Sentrex сказал:

    reg.ru?

    Был года 2 на нем - ушел, когда поддержка 2 дня не могла решить мою проблему. Причем, решение я знал сам, но, имея VPS? не мог сделать то, что требовалось.

    Ушел к другому хостеру, по акции взял VDS - доволен.

×
×
  • Создать...